Output 554cc3fc5986dce5a582e3cda142af1ba4888c9004a07c96024c60baafb30069:12

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88a04258374fe96ed41a24bd95af75a56c378208 OP_EQUAL
address
3E9Rodjq7GkQAEC8NcDgtAdsR1KXKXtRDz
transaction
554cc3fc5986dce5a582e3cda142af1ba4888c9004a07c96024c60baafb30069
spent
true